Considerations for Metal Buildings

When locating security cameras on a large metal building, there are several key considerations to keep in mind:

1. Material Interference

Due to the reflective properties of metal, cameras may experience glare or reflection issues when mounted directly on the surface of a metal building. To avoid this, consider using mounting brackets or housings to position the cameras at an angle that minimizes interference.

2. Signal Strength

Metal buildings can interfere with wireless signals, affecting the connectivity of wireless security cameras. To ensure optimal signal strength, consider using wired cameras or installing signal boosters to overcome any potential signal disruptions caused by the metal structure.

Strategic Placement of Cameras

When locating security cameras on a large metal building, it is essential to strategically place them to ensure maximum coverage and effectiveness. Here are some key tips for placing cameras:

  • Position cameras at entrances and exits to monitor who is coming in and out of the building.
  • Place cameras at vulnerable points such as windows, loading docks, and other areas prone to break-ins.
  • Ensure cameras are positioned high enough to avoid tampering or vandalism.
  • Consider the lighting conditions and avoid placing cameras in areas with direct sunlight or glare.
  • Use a combination of fixed and PTZ (pan-tilt-zoom) cameras to cover different angles and areas.
  • Test the camera angles and views to make sure there are no blind spots in the coverage.

Avoiding Blind Spots

When installing security cameras on a large metal building, it’s crucial to avoid blind spots that could compromise the effectiveness of your surveillance system. Here are some tips to help you ensure comprehensive coverage:

1. Strategic Placement

Position cameras at key entry points, such as doors, windows, and loading docks, to capture all activity. Consider the building’s layout and potential blind spots, such as corners or areas obstructed by equipment, and adjust camera angles accordingly.

2. Use Pan-Tilt-Zoom (PTZ) Cameras

PTZ cameras provide flexibility to adjust the field of view remotely, allowing you to monitor different areas of the building without the need for multiple fixed cameras. This can help eliminate blind spots and enhance overall surveillance coverage.

Wiring and Connectivity

When locating security cameras on a large metal building, it is crucial to consider the wiring and connectivity aspects to ensure proper functioning and surveillance coverage. Here are some key points to keep in mind:

1. Plan the camera placement strategically to minimize the length of wiring required and ensure easy access for maintenance.

2. Use high-quality, weatherproof cables and connectors to withstand the harsh outdoor environment and protect against interference.

3. Consider using wireless cameras for areas where running cables is challenging or not feasible, but ensure a reliable Wi-Fi or cellular network connection.

4. Install a power source near each camera location to avoid long cable runs and potential voltage drop issues.

5. Utilize a centralized recording or monitoring system to manage and view footage from multiple cameras efficiently.

By paying attention to wiring and connectivity considerations, you can ensure a reliable and effective security camera system on your large metal building.

Power Source Options

When it comes to powering security cameras on a large metal building, there are several options to consider:

  • Solar power: Installing solar panels on the roof of the building can provide a sustainable and environmentally friendly power source for your cameras.
  • Hardwired power: Running power cables from the building’s main electrical supply is a reliable option for continuous power to the cameras.
  • Battery-powered cameras: Opting for cameras with rechargeable batteries can provide flexibility in placement and reduce the need for wiring.
  • Power over Ethernet (PoE): If the building has a network infrastructure in place, PoE cameras can draw power from the Ethernet cable, simplifying installation.

Consider the location of the cameras, accessibility to power sources, and the level of maintenance required when choosing the power source for your security system.

Remote Access and Monitoring

Once you have located security cameras on your large metal building, it is essential to set up remote access and monitoring capabilities. This will allow you to keep an eye on your property from anywhere at any time, enhancing security and peace of mind.

By connecting your security cameras to a network video recorder (NVR) or a cloud-based surveillance system, you can access live footage and recordings remotely via a smartphone, tablet, or computer. Make sure to secure your remote access with strong passwords and enable encryption to protect your data.
